Description
Ca. 1-300 AD. A bronze herm pendant of a quadrangular post narrowing downwards, and at the top ending with a bust of a man with his hair swept back and a large loop protruding from the top of his head. His face bears simplified features and his unworked body is marked only with genitals. A herm is an architectural decorative element with a head and a plain torso with only genitals carved. Such sculptures were placed along roads, on street corners, at gates, in gymnasiums, on property borders, etc.Size: L:117mm / W:25.6mm ; 80.06gProvenance: From the private collection of a South London art professional; previously in a collection formed on the UK/European art market in the 1980s;
